Arcadia Man With Schizophrenia Reported Missing

ARCADIA (CBSLA.com) — Police Sunday sought the public's help in locating a 44-year-old Arcadia man who suffers from paranoid schizophrenia.

Blair Christopher Polk had recently made suicidal statements, police said.

He was last seen around 1:15 p.m. Saturday at his Arcadia home.

Polk was described as a 5-foot, 7-inch tall white and weighing 155 pounds. He has green eyes and brown hair in a ponytail. He has a scar or mark on his chin. He was last seen wearing dark-colored shorts, a T-shirt and sneakers.
